Mejora la experiencia de usuario en tu sitio web: los 10 principios de usabilidad de Jakob Nielsen que debes conocer
Jakob Nielsen es un reconocido experto en usabilidad y diseño de interfaces de usuario. Nació en Dinamarca en 1957 y es uno de los pioneros en el campo de la experiencia de usuario (UX). Es conocido por sus investigaciones y…
Jakob Nielsen es un reconocido experto en usabilidad y diseño de interfaces de usuario. Nació en Dinamarca en 1957 y es uno de los pioneros en el campo de la experiencia de usuario (UX). Es conocido por sus investigaciones y publicaciones en el campo de la usabilidad, la accesibilidad web y el diseño centrado en el usuario.
Su trabajo ha tenido un gran impacto en la industria del diseño y la tecnología, y sus principios de usabilidad son ampliamente reconocidos y utilizados en la creación de interfaces digitales en todo el mundo.
Los 10 principios de usabilidad de Jakob Nielsen
Visibilidad del estado del sistema:Es fundamental que el usuario se sienta seguro y confiado en todo momento mientras navega en una página web. Se trata de mantener al usuario informado sobre el estado del sistema en todo momento. Por esta razón, la interfaz debe utilizar técnicas de diseño de usabilidad que le permitan saber en todo momento su ubicación y lo que está sucediendo en la página. Esto no solo evitará confusiones, sino que también mejorará su experiencia como usuario, haciéndola mucho más placentera.Entre las diferentes técnicas de diseño, se destaca el uso de «breadcrumbs», que permiten al usuario conocer en qué nivel de profundidad se encuentra dentro de la web. Además, la utilización de «friendly URLs» es altamente efectiva, ya que permite al usuario identificar fácilmente la página en la que se encuentra. Otro método efectivo es el uso de colores diferenciados en el menú, que indican al usuario en qué página se encuentra navegando.Por ejemplo, si un usuario envía un formulario de contacto, el sistema debe proporcionar una respuesta clara y visible que confirme que se ha enviado correctamente. Cuando enviamos un correo electrónico, Gmail nos muestra una notificación visual en la parte superior de la pantalla que confirma que el mensaje ha sido enviado. Esto reduce la ansiedad del usuario y aumenta la confianza en el sistema. Otro ejemplo puede ser cuando utilizamos una aplicación de viajes como Uber, que nos muestra el tiempo estimado de llegada del conductor en tiempo real.
Correspondencia entre el sistema y el mundo real:Es crucial que tengamos en cuenta que la mayoría de los usuarios tienen poco conocimiento sobre el mundo digital. El sistema debe hablar el mismo idioma que los usuarios. Los términos, las funciones y las acciones del sistema deben ser fáciles de entender y relacionarse con la vida cotidiana del usuario. Por lo tanto, es necesario crear elementos que estén asociados al mundo real, el cual es lo que el usuario realmente conoce. De esta manera, podemos hacer que la experiencia dentro de la interfaz sea más fácil y sencilla.Un excelente ejemplo es Amazon, que mediante el uso de técnicas de usabilidad adecúa su interfaz para que al usuario le parezca que está comprando en una tienda física. Utiliza iconografía que se asocia con elementos del mundo real, como la cesta de la compra para la opción «Añadir al carro», lo que facilita la comprensión de la interfaz por parte del usuario.Por ejemplo, el botón de «Enviar» en un formulario debe ser fácilmente reconocible y tener un significado claro para el usuario. El icono de la papelera en un programa es fácilmente reconocible y tiene un significado claro para el usuario, ya que se asocia con la acción de «eliminar». Otro ejemplo es el botón de «Atrás» en los navegadores web, que es fácil de entender por qué se relaciona con la acción de «regresar» a la página anterior.
Control y libertad del usuario:Es esencial que el usuario tenga libertad dentro de la interfaz. Es importante que los usuarios tengan la capacidad de controlar su experiencia y sentirse libres para cambiar de opinión o deshacer acciones. Debe tener la posibilidad de volver a la página anterior, deshacer y rehacer acciones que ha ejecutado dentro de la interfaz, o tener varias maneras de navegación dentro del sitio web.En las aplicaciones, una buena práctica para garantizar la libertad del usuario es el uso de iconografía. Por ejemplo, el uso de flechas comunica de manera visual que el usuario puede retroceder en la app, lo que proporciona un mayor control sobre la experiencia de navegación.Es importante recordar que el usuario necesita sentirse cómodo y seguro mientras navega en una página web o aplicación. Si el usuario se siente atrapado o limitado en su libertad, es más probable que abandone el sitio web o desinstale la aplicación. Por lo tanto, es fundamental garantizar la libertad y el control del usuario en la interfaz.Por ejemplo, si un usuario agrega un producto al carrito de compras, debe poder eliminarlo fácilmente en caso de que cambie de opinión. En un videojuego, el usuario debe tener la capacidad de pausar el juego y guardar su progreso en cualquier momento, lo que le brinda el control sobre su experiencia de juego.
Consistencia y estándares:Es absolutamente crucial que nuestra interfaz sea homogénea. Nuestra página web debe utilizar la misma tipografía, colores, iconografía o estilo de imágenes en toda su navegación, para no confundir al usuario y facilitar su aprendizaje de la interfaz. Es importante mantener la consistencia en la forma en que se presentan los elementos y la funcionalidad. Los usuarios no quieren tener que aprender nuevas formas de interactuar con cada sistema que utilizan.Si en cada página de nuestro sitio web usamos estilos de comunicación diferentes o estilos de navegación completamente diferentes, esto solo confundirá al usuario y empeorará su experiencia de usabilidad. Debemos recordar que el usuario busca comodidad y facilidad al navegar por nuestro sitio web, y esto solo puede ser logrado mediante la consistencia y la homogeneidad en la interfaz.Es importante tener en cuenta que la homogeneidad no significa monotonía. Podemos utilizar diferentes elementos visuales para crear una interfaz atractiva y agradable a la vista del usuario, pero siempre debemos asegurarnos de que estén en armonía con el diseño general del sitio web.Por ejemplo, los botones de «Aceptar» y «Cancelar» deben estar en el mismo lugar y tener el mismo diseño en todas las pantallas del sistema. Los menús de navegación en las webs también deben ser consistentes en toda la página y seguir un estándar de organización.
Prevención de errores:Es esencial que inspeccionemos nuestra interfaz a fondo para evitar cualquier error que pueda afectar la navegación del usuario. Debemos asegurarnos de que los formularios se validen correctamente, de que no haya páginas duplicadas y de que los elementos se visualicen adecuadamente en cualquier dispositivo (PC, smartphone, Tablet, etc.). Es fundamental diseñar interfaces que eviten que los usuarios cometan errores. Esto se puede lograr mediante mensajes de confirmación o la limitación de opciones que puedan llevar a errores.La verdad es que existen muchos posibles errores que nuestra interfaz podría tener, pero es nuestra responsabilidad detectarlos y solucionarlos para proporcionar a nuestros usuarios la mejor experiencia de navegación posible. Debemos recordar que cada pequeño detalle cuenta, y que la falta de atención en uno de estos detalles podría llevar a la pérdida de un usuario o cliente.Nuestra interfaz debe estar libre de errores para que nuestros usuarios puedan disfrutar plenamente de ella y realizar todas las acciones que necesiten sin ningún obstáculo.Por ejemplo, si un usuario debe seleccionar una fecha en un formulario, el sistema debe presentar un calendario en lugar de permitir que el usuario escriba la fecha manualmente. Cuando llenamos un formulario en línea, se nos muestra una alerta si dejamos un campo obligatorio vacío para evitar el error de enviar el formulario incompleto. Los programas de edición de texto también incluyen un corrector ortográfico para prevenir errores de escritura.
Reconocimiento en lugar de recuerdo:¡Queremos que nuestros usuarios se sientan como en casa en nuestra interfaz! Por eso, es importante que siempre les mostremos todas las acciones y opciones disponibles en cada momento. De esta manera, evitamos que tengan que recordar opciones o acciones que ya realizaron previamente, lo que les permite ahorrar memoria y concentrarse en lo que realmente importa. El sistema debe estar diseñado para que el usuario no tenga que recordar información de una pantalla a otra. La información relevante debe estar disponible en todo momento.Al ofrecer todas las opciones «en bandeja» al usuario, les brindamos una experiencia más cómoda y agradable, mejorando así la usabilidad de nuestra interfaz. Queremos que nuestros usuarios se sientan empoderados y capaces de realizar cualquier tarea en nuestra plataforma de manera sencilla y sin complicaciones.Por ejemplo, en un ecommerce, el carrito de compras debe mostrar una lista de los productos agregados, así como el precio y la cantidad. En una plataforma de streaming, la lista de «Continuar viendo» muestra los programas y películas que el usuario ha visto recientemente para evitar que tenga que recordar cuál fue el último episodio que vio.
Flexibilidad y eficiencia de uso:¡Queremos que nuestros usuarios disfruten de la experiencia de navegación más fluida y eficiente posible en nuestra plataforma! Por ello, es fundamental que ofrezcamos distintas maneras de navegar, para que cada usuario pueda elegir la opción que mejor se adapte a sus necesidades y preferencias. El sistema debe ser diseñado para permitir a los usuarios realizar tareas de manera rápida y eficiente. También es importante que los usuarios puedan personalizar la interfaz para adaptarla a sus necesidades.Una buena práctica es el uso de menús desplegables, que permiten una navegación rápida y sencilla por las distintas secciones del sitio web. También es importante contar con enlaces internos bien ubicados, que faciliten al usuario el acceso a contenidos relacionados y aumenten la interconexión entre las distintas secciones de la plataforma.Además, no podemos olvidar la importancia de los motores de búsqueda internos, que permiten a los usuarios encontrar rápidamente el contenido que están buscando. Estas prácticas de flexibilidad no solo mejoran la eficiencia del sitio web, sino que también contribuyen a una experiencia de navegación más agradable y satisfactoria para nuestros usuarios.Por ejemplo, un usuario debe poder agregar sus productos favoritos a una lista de deseos para acceder a ellos rápidamente en el futuro. En una aplicación de correo electrónico, el usuario puede personalizar las opciones de notificación y la configuración de la bandeja de entrada para adaptarla a sus necesidades. En un programa de edición de video, el usuario puede personalizar los atajos de teclado para realizar tareas de manera más rápida y eficiente.
Diseño estético y minimalista:A veces menos es más, y en el diseño de interfaces esto es muy importante. Elimina todo aquello que sea irrelevante para destacar lo verdaderamente importante para el usuario. Simplificar la interfaz no solo mejora la usabilidad, sino que también puede aumentar las conversiones. La utilización de espacios en blanco, iconografía y llamados a la acción (CTAs) pueden mejorar tu diseño minimalista y hacer que tu sitio web sea más fácil de usar y de entender para el usuario.El diseño debe ser atractivo y limpio. El usuario no debe distraerse con elementos innecesarios o desordenados en la interfaz. El diseño debe ser simple y fácil de entender para que el usuario pueda enfocarse en la tarea que está realizando. Las aplicaciones de mensajería también utilizan una interfaz limpia y sencilla para que el usuario se concentre en la conversación.
Ayuda a los usuarios a reconocer, diagnosticar y recuperarse de los errores:¡No hay nada más frustrante que intentar hacer algo en una interfaz y encontrarse con un error que no se entiende! Es fundamental que nuestra plataforma comunique de manera clara y concisa cualquier tipo de error que pueda surgir en la interacción con el usuario. Solo así podremos garantizar una experiencia de usabilidad óptima para nuestros usuarios.Si un usuario comete un error, el sistema debe proporcionar una solución fácil de entender y utilizar. Por ejemplo, si un usuario ingresa una dirección de correo electrónico incorrecta en un formulario, el sistema debe mostrar un mensaje de error claro y ofrecer una solución para corregir el error. Cuando un usuario intenta iniciar sesión en una plataforma en línea y escribe una contraseña incorrecta, el sistema le muestra un mensaje de error claro y le indica cómo corregir el error. En una aplicación de edición de fotos, si el usuario realiza una acción que no se puede deshacer, se muestra una alerta para que el usuario pueda reconsiderar su acción.
Ayuda y documentación:El último principio de usabilidad de Jakob Nielsen se refiere a proporcionar ayuda y documentación a los usuarios que la necesiten. Aunque se debe hacer todo lo posible para evitar que los usuarios necesiten ayuda, a veces es inevitable que surjan preguntas o problemas. En esos casos, el sistema debe proporcionar la información necesaria de manera clara y fácil de entender. ¡El usuario es lo más importante! Debemos estar siempre dispuestos a ayudar y facilitarle la navegación en nuestra interfaz. No podemos dar por hecho que entienda todo a la perfección, por lo que es nuestra responsabilidad ofrecerle toda la ayuda posible para que pueda aprovechar al máximo nuestra plataforma.Las webs de soporte técnico a menudo incluyen una sección de preguntas frecuentes (FAQ) que ayuda a los usuarios a resolver sus problemas comunes.
Es importante recordar que la experiencia del usuario es un factor crítico en el éxito de cualquier sitio web. Si los usuarios se sienten cómodos y seguros navegando en una página, es más probable que regresen y la recomienden a otros. Por lo tanto, la implementación de estas técnicas de usabilidad no solo mejora la experiencia del usuario, sino que también puede tener un impacto positivo en el éxito del sitio web en su conjunto.
Estos principios son importantes para garantizar una experiencia de usuario positiva y exitosa. Al seguir estos principios, se puede crear una interfaz intuitiva y fácil de usar que aumentará la satisfacción del usuario y reducirá la frustración. Al final del día, la usabilidad es clave para el éxito de cualquier producto o servicio en línea. ¡Así que asegúrate de tenerlos en cuenta al diseñar tu próximo proyecto!
¿Necesitas ayuda con tu proyecto?
Cuéntame qué necesitas y te propongo un plan personalizado para impulsar tu negocio online.
Solicita tu consulta gratuita